In temporarily occupied Crimea, a new wave of Russian filtration measures has begun. Specifically, the enemy is blocking entire areas and conducting thorough checks of residents, according to the National Resistance Center (NRC).

"These filtration measures have begun on the seized peninsula to identify undesirable elements," the report states.

According to the news source, everything is taking place under the guise of military exercises called BARS-Crimea. Meanwhile, local gauleiter Sergey Aksyonov has urged Crimeans to assist in conducting the drills.

The NRC noted that such raids are conducted regularly by the Russians in temporarily occupied territories of Ukraine. Recently, there has been increased scrutiny of all civilians planning to leave the occupied part of the Kherson region, specifically targeting Ukrainians who have not exchanged their Ukrainian citizenship for a Russian passport.
